Biography of Shania Twain

Shania Twain was born as Eilleen Regina Edwards in Windsor, Ontario, Canada. She is the daughter of Clarence Edwards and Georgina Twain. After her parents' divorce, she was raised by her mother and stepfather, Jerry Twain. In her youth, Shania faced financial hardships and family struggles, yet she found solace in music.

Early Life

Shania Twain's early life was marked by struggles. Growing up in a low-income family, she began singing at local events to help support her family at the age of eight. By the time she was 13, she was performing in bars and clubs. Her determination and talent caught the attention of music producers, leading her to a recording contract at a young age.

Musical Career

Shania's career took off with the release of her debut album, "Shania Twain," in 1993. However, it was her second album, "The Woman in Me" (1995), that catapulted her to fame. Featuring hits like "Any Man of Mine" and "You Win My Love," this album established her as a leading figure in the country music genre.

Rise to Fame

Shania's third album, "Come On Over" (1997), became the best-selling studio album of all time by a female artist, with over 40 million copies sold worldwide. The album featured iconic songs like "Man! I Feel Like a Woman!" and "You're Still the One," which reached the top of the charts in multiple countries. Her ability to blend country and pop elements appealed to a broad audience, allowing her to dominate the music scene.

Personal Life

Shania Twain's personal life has been marked by both triumphs and challenges. She was married to music producer Mutt Lange, with whom she collaborated on many successful projects. However, their marriage ended in divorce after Lange's infidelity. Twain later married Frédéric Thiébaud, who was once a close friend of hers, and they have been together since 2011.
